No objection from me. Great effort.
Maybe we want to consider in the future:
a) Using the Antora Maven Plugin [1].
b) Give the site a redesign.
c) Reconsider having many different repositories. These make sense if
things evolve at different speed and you want to version them, otherwise
we may want to have everything in a single repo.
Cheers,
Antonio
[1]
https://gitlab.com/antora/antora-maven-plugin
On 25/10/23 15:44, Eric Barboni wrote:
Hi,
As there it seems no objection. Works on fixing 404 (only on our "internal
reference") and making better docs can continue later.
I thinks it's almost the same content but publishable.
PR ready for trying to publiush live is here:
https://github.com/apache/netbeans-antora/pull/9
Best Regards
Eric
-----Message d'origine-----
De : Antonio <anto...@vieiro.net.INVALID>
Envoyé : mardi 17 octobre 2023 19:21
À : dev@netbeans.apache.org
Objet : Re: [LAZY CONSENSUS] migrating our cms to antora
Hi,
Some comments inline below:
On 17/10/23 14:45, Eric Barboni wrote:
Hi, Using a asf-staging branches to get it works via jenkins. Maybe
Then maybe we want to close
https://issues.apache.org/jira/browse/INFRA-25089 with a "works for me"
or something.
The CI build script at
https://ci-builds.apache.org/job/Netbeans/job/netbeans-antora-website/configure
has a "Credentials" drop box on each repository. We could add a new repository there with
proper credentials but if the "asf-staging" branch works then I'd leave it as is.
after a refresh a search bar should appears left to community. (lunr
D'oh! So if I type "AbstractNode" I get a popup window with documents
explaining it?. This is cool. Great work!
(screenshot from
https://netbeans-antora.staged.apache.org/front/main/index.html at
https://ibb.co/c28CScj )
We may want to index the tutorials too (I've just seen wiki results). If the
index for search gets big (as I presume will happen) we can always move to
server-side search.
extension). The UI is close to current website, if we wanna change we
need a plan. But we are able to publish again via this setup so easier
to see a future.
Yep. Also the whole Antora structure/etc. should be documented somewhere
(probably in a section under
https://cwiki.apache.org/confluence/display/NETBEANS/NetBeans+Site). I can help
with that as time permits, if we finally move onto Antora.
Cheers,
Antonio
---------------------------------------------------------------------
To unsubscribe, e-mail: dev-unsubscr...@netbeans.apache.org
For additional commands, e-mail: dev-h...@netbeans.apache.org
For further information about the NetBeans mailing lists, visit:
https://cwiki.apache.org/confluence/display/NETBEANS/Mailing+lists
---------------------------------------------------------------------
To unsubscribe, e-mail: dev-unsubscr...@netbeans.apache.org
For additional commands, e-mail: dev-h...@netbeans.apache.org
For further information about the NetBeans mailing lists, visit:
https://cwiki.apache.org/confluence/display/NETBEANS/Mailing+lists
---------------------------------------------------------------------
To unsubscribe, e-mail: dev-unsubscr...@netbeans.apache.org
For additional commands, e-mail: dev-h...@netbeans.apache.org
For further information about the NetBeans mailing lists, visit:
https://cwiki.apache.org/confluence/display/NETBEANS/Mailing+lists